Build a Debt Paydown Plan Without Ignoring the Rest of Your Finances

Organize debt payments while protecting essential cash flow and a small safety buffer.

List the details

Record each balance, interest rate, minimum payment and due date. Debt feels less vague when it becomes a list of specific numbers and decisions.

Protect minimum payments

Before accelerating one balance, make sure required minimums across the rest are covered. Your strategy should sit on top of a stable payment foundation.

Choose a method you can maintain

Some people prioritize the highest interest rate; others clear the smallest balance first for motivation. The mathematically best method is not useful if you abandon it, so consider cost and behavior together.

Keep some resilience

Sending every available unit of cash to debt can create a new borrowing cycle when a surprise arrives. Depending on your situation, a modest emergency buffer can protect progress.
